Abstract

PURPOSE:To miniaturize the electromagnet by a method wherein, in an electromagnetic contactor, an electromagnetic brake, or the direct current electromagnet to be used for other various uses, a lead switch is mounted on the wiring circuit of the above, and the current to be applied before and after attraction is controlled. CONSTITUTION:The circuit, with which a current is supplied to the wiring circuit 11 constituting the direct current electromagnet, is constituted as follows; namely, a circuit wherein a resistor 12 and the contacting piece 13 of a relay 15 are connected in parallel, are inserted between a closing contact piece 14 and a wiring circuit 11. Also, a lead switch 36 located along the wiring circuit 11 is connected on the input side of the relay 15. If the electromagnet is constituted as above, the magnetic flux when the movable core of the electromagnet is attracted has a large consumption percentage at a large air gap, the magnetic flux density of the core can be reduced, the core is saturated as the air-gap becoming smaller due to the attracted movable core, and the leakage magnetic flux is rapidly increased. Thus, the lead switch 36 is turned ON to actuate the relay 15 and the contacting piece 13 is turned OFF. A resistance 12 is inserted into the coil 11 thus to decrease the current passing through the coil 11.
